    Redgum were an Australian folk and political music group formed in Adelaide in 1975 by singer-songwriter John Schumann, Michael Atkinson on guitars/vocals, Verity Truman on flute/vocals; they were later joined by Hugh McDonald on fiddle and Chris Timms on violin.

  3. 22 de ago. de 2014 · Red gum ‘I was only 19‘ is a song sung from the point of view of a returned Vietnam war veteran. The song highlights the psychological effects of a traumatic war experience, and the futility of youth in the Vietnam War.
